Pacific Internet is a premier provider of Colocation, Disaster Recovery, Connectivity, Hosting, VOIP, Web Development, and IT services for businesses within Washington State, across the US, and around the World. Pacific Internet operates from several datacenter facilities in the Seattle, Washington region, which services local, national, and international clients. Knowing that every company is unique, Pacific Internet specializes in solutions to fit your specific needs and within your dedicated budget. Pacific Internet is also a locally owned and operated provider within Western Washington providing a variety of connectivity solutions for both business and residential customers. Connections range from fiber optic connections, to T1s and DS3s, to the revolutionary true bonded-DSL service only available through Pacific Internet, and even basic legacy DSL or dialup services. The partners and staff at Pacific Internet have a combined 60+ years experience in Internet, telecommunications, technology, and hosting, giving them both the knowledge and practical experience necessary to guide Pacific Internet to a market-leading position in the internet services arena.

  1. Digital Marketing: Digital marketing is the marketing of products or services using digital technologies, mainly on the Internet, but also including mobile phones, display advertising, and any other digital medium. Digital marketing's development since the 1990s and 2000s has changed the way brands and businesses use technology for marketing. As digital platforms are increasingly incorporated into marketing plans and everyday life, and as people use digital devices instead of visiting physical shops, digital marketing campaigns are becoming more prevalent and efficient. Digital marketing methods such as search engine optimization (SEO), search engine marketing (SEM), content marketing, influencer marketing, content automation, campaign marketing, data-driven marketing, e-commerce marketing, social media marketing, social media optimization, e-mail direct marketing, Display advertising, e–books, and optical disks and games are becoming more common in our advancing technology. In fact, digital marketing now extends to non-Internet channels that provide digital media, such as mobile phones (SMS and MMS), callback, and on-hold mobile ring tones. In essence, this extension to non-Internet channels helps to differentiate digital marketing from online marketing, another catch-all term for the marketing methods mentioned above, which strictly occur online.

  4. Advertising: Advertising is a marketing communication that employs an openly sponsored, non-personal message to promote or sell a product, service or idea.:465 Sponsors of advertising are typically businesses wishing to promote their products or services. Advertising is differentiated from public relations in that an advertiser pays for and has control over the message. It differs from personal selling in that the message is non-personal, i.e., not directed to a particular individual.:661,672 Advertising is communicated through various mass media, including traditional media such as newspapers, magazines, television, radio, outdoor advertising or direct mail; and new media such as search results, blogs, social media, websites or text messages. The actual presentation of the message in a medium is referred to as an advertisement, or "ad" or advert for short. Commercial ads often seek to generate increased consumption of their products or services through "branding", which associates a product name or image with certain qualities in the minds of consumers. On the other hand, ads that intend to elicit an immediate sale are known as direct-response advertising. Non-commercial entities that advertise more than consumer products or services include political parties, interest groups, religious organizations and governmental agencies. Non-profit organizations may use free modes of persuasion, such as a public service announcement. Advertising may also help to reassure employees or shareholders that a company is viable or successful.
